| + /*************************************************************************/
|
| + /* */
|
| + /* <Function> */
|
| + /* FT_Raccess_Guess */
|
| + /* */
|
| + /* <Description> */
|
| + /* Guess a file name and offset where the actual resource fork is */
|
| + /* stored. The macro FT_RACCESS_N_RULES holds the number of */
|
| + /* guessing rules; the guessed result for the Nth rule is */
|
| + /* represented as a triplet: a new file name (new_names[N]), a file */
|
| + /* offset (offsets[N]), and an error code (errors[N]). */
|
| + /* */
|
| + /* <Input> */
|
| + /* library :: */
|
| + /* A FreeType library instance. */
|
| + /* */
|
| + /* stream :: */
|
| + /* A file stream containing the resource fork. */
|
| + /* */
|
| + /* base_name :: */
|
| + /* The (base) file name of the resource fork used for some */
|
| + /* guessing rules. */
|
| + /* */
|
| + /* <Output> */
|
| + /* new_names :: */
|
| + /* An array of guessed file names in which the resource forks may */
|
| + /* exist. If `new_names[N]' is NULL, the guessed file name is */
|
| + /* equal to `base_name'. */
|
| + /* */
|
| + /* offsets :: */
|
| + /* An array of guessed file offsets. `offsets[N]' holds the file */
|
| + /* offset of the possible start of the resource fork in file */
|
| + /* `new_names[N]'. */
|
| + /* */
|
| + /* errors :: */
|
| + /* An array of FreeType error codes. `errors[N]' is the error */
|
| + /* code of Nth guessing rule function. If `errors[N]' is not */
|
| + /* FT_Err_Ok, `new_names[N]' and `offsets[N]' are meaningless. */
|
| + /* */
|
| + FT_BASE( void )
|
| + FT_Raccess_Guess( FT_Library library,
|
| + FT_Stream stream,
|
| + char* base_name,
|
| + char** new_names,
|
| + FT_Long* offsets,
|
| + FT_Error* errors );

| + /*************************************************************************/
|
| + /* */
|
| + /* <Function> */
|
| + /* FT_Raccess_Get_HeaderInfo */
|
| + /* */
|
| + /* <Description> */
|
| + /* Get the information from the header of resource fork. The */
|
| + /* information includes the file offset where the resource map */
|
| + /* starts, and the file offset where the resource data starts. */
|
| + /* `FT_Raccess_Get_DataOffsets' requires these two data. */
|
| + /* */
|
| + /* <Input> */
|
| + /* library :: */
|
| + /* A FreeType library instance. */
|
| + /* */
|
| + /* stream :: */
|
| + /* A file stream containing the resource fork. */
|
| + /* */
|
| + /* rfork_offset :: */
|
| + /* The file offset where the resource fork starts. */
|
| + /* */
|
| + /* <Output> */
|
| + /* map_offset :: */
|
| + /* The file offset where the resource map starts. */
|
| + /* */
|
| + /* rdata_pos :: */
|
| + /* The file offset where the resource data starts. */
|
| + /* */
|
| + /* <Return> */
|
| + /* FreeType error code. FT_Err_Ok means success. */
|
| + /* */
|
| + FT_BASE( FT_Error )
|
| + FT_Raccess_Get_HeaderInfo( FT_Library library,
|
| + FT_Stream stream,
|
| + FT_Long rfork_offset,
|
| + FT_Long *map_offset,
|
| + FT_Long *rdata_pos );

| + /*************************************************************************/
|
| + /* */
|
| + /* <Function> */
|
| + /* FT_Raccess_Get_DataOffsets */
|
| + /* */
|
| + /* <Description> */
|
| + /* Get the data offsets for a tag in a resource fork. Offsets are */
|
| + /* stored in an array because, in some cases, resources in a resource */
|
| + /* fork have the same tag. */
|
| + /* */
|
| + /* <Input> */
|
| + /* library :: */
|
| + /* A FreeType library instance. */
|
| + /* */
|
| + /* stream :: */
|
| + /* A file stream containing the resource fork. */
|
| + /* */
|
| + /* map_offset :: */
|
| + /* The file offset where the resource map starts. */
|
| + /* */
|
| + /* rdata_pos :: */
|
| + /* The file offset where the resource data starts. */
|
| + /* */
|
| + /* tag :: */
|
| + /* The resource tag. */
|
| + /* */
|
| + /* sort_by_res_id :: */
|
| + /* A Boolean to sort the fragmented resource by their ids. */
|
| + /* The fragmented resources for `POST' resource should be sorted */
|
| + /* to restore Type1 font properly. For `snft' resources, sorting */
|
| + /* may induce a different order of the faces in comparison to that */
|
| + /* by QuickDraw API. */
|
| + /* */
|
| + /* <Output> */
|
| + /* offsets :: */
|
| + /* The stream offsets for the resource data specified by `tag'. */
|
| + /* This array is allocated by the function, so you have to call */
|
| + /* @ft_mem_free after use. */
|
| + /* */
|
| + /* count :: */
|
| + /* The length of offsets array. */
|
| + /* */
|
| + /* <Return> */
|
| + /* FreeType error code. FT_Err_Ok means success. */
|
| + /* */
|
| + /* <Note> */
|
| + /* Normally you should use `FT_Raccess_Get_HeaderInfo' to get the */
|
| + /* value for `map_offset' and `rdata_pos'. */
|
| + /* */
|
| + FT_BASE( FT_Error )
|
| + FT_Raccess_Get_DataOffsets( FT_Library library,
|
| + FT_Stream stream,
|
| + FT_Long map_offset,
|
| + FT_Long rdata_pos,
|
| + FT_Long tag,
|
| + FT_Bool sort_by_res_id,
|
| + FT_Long **offsets,
|
| + FT_Long *count );
